Talons out as swim and dive heads to TISCA

After a strong season, the Redhawks swim and dive team is out to compete in the TISCA 5A Invitational Thursday. The Redhawks will send 20 athletes, in the hopes of advancing to the finals on Saturday.

The Redhawk swim and dive team has their sights set on strong finishes during the North Texas 5A TISCA Invitational at the Bruce Eubanks Natatorium starting Thursday. This year, the team will be sending a record-breaking 20 athletes to compete against more than 300 others.

 

“I feel pretty good overall,” head coach Zachariah Gnoza said. “We have had some great success already this year. This will let us know where we stand going into the break [and] give us a good look at what regionals will be like. I expect to see some fast races [because] we will have some of the fastest teams in the region this weekend and I just want the team to stay competitive.”

 

With the Redhawks going up against some tough competition, freshman Vir Gandhi is eager to see how he has improved since the start of the season in October.

 

“I want to try for faster times again and do better at controlling my energy,” Gandhi said.
